Andrew Boyce

Andrew is a partner in the corporate and finance team and is recognised both locally and internationally for investment and finance transactions across all entity types. Andrew has specialist experience in the structuring and establishment of open and closed-ended investment funds and the credit and structured finance products related to them. In particular he has built an enviable reputation in his core expertise of private equity fund formation having advised a range of global investment houses as well as new managers on fund establishment, investment structuring, asset acquisitions and disposals and regulatory issues. Andrew's banking and finance expertise compliments his investment funds core practice and covers a range of credit types including capital call facilities, leveraged financing and asset finance. He has acted for global banking institutions and alternative credit providers as well as institutional borrowers. Andrew is instructed by leading UK, European and international law firms and financial institutions, and is recognised by global legal directories and publications. As a qualified British Virgin Islands lawyer Andrew also advises on the above in relation to British Virgin Islands law from his base in Guernsey. · Carey Olsen
